Jeremiah Johnson led Rudder (3-12) with 10 points, and JoDarius Hayward had eight, but going 7 for 24 at the free-throw line ultimately hurt any chance the Rangers had of catching the Spartans.
Tahaad Davis and Stennett Prior led Seven Lakes (10-6) with 12 points each.
Rudder will open play in the Madisonville tournament against Teague at 9 a.m. and Shepherd at 3 p.m. Dec. 27.
